Maria Wasti (born August 14, 1980) is a Pakistani film, television actress and host. She currently hosts the game show ''Croron Mein Khel'' on the Pakistani television channel BOL Entertainment.

In other equally applauded roles, she played a victim in '' Baadlon Par Basera'', who is forcefully led into marriage with a man in the United States on the phone and when she meets him for the first time, she realises the man is older than the picture she saw him in. Wasti is usually seen playing unglamorous roles involving sensitive issues regarding women in Pakistan. She has played roles depicting prominent women like Salma Murad and
Bilquis Edhi Bilquis Bano Edhi ( ur, ; 14 August 1947 – 15 April 2022) was a Pakistani nurse who helped save the lives of over 16,000 children. During her career as a nurse and marriage to Abdul Sattar Edhi, she was one of the most active philanthropis ...
. Wasti is known for being outspoken on various of issues like women's rights, harassment, gender equality and prejudice.

Wasti has expressed that newer Pakistani plays should portray issues in today's Pakistan. She names drugs and
AIDS Human immunodeficiency virus infection and ac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(HIV/AIDS) is a spectrum of conditions caused by infection with the human immunodeficiency virus (HIV), a retrovirus. Following initial infection an individual m ...
being amongst the most sensitive. She also cites the reason for the decrease in the quality of drama serials as being the lack of a supply of actors, actresses, writers, directors and producers. In view of these thoughts, Wasti opened a production house in 2002, where she has successfully produced several serials and a dozen plays.
